WebMay 30, 2024 · Example: Finding the critical chi-square value. Since there are three intervention groups (flyer, phone call, and control) and two outcome groups (recycle and does not recycle) there are (3 − 1) * (2 − 1) = 2 degrees of freedom. For a test of significance at α = .05 and df = 2, the Χ 2 critical value is 5.99. diabetic heat yeast rash

WebJul 19, 2024 · There are several functions in Excel that we can use when dealing with chi-square distributions. The first of these is CHISQ.DIST ( ). This function returns the left-tailed probability of the chi-squared distribution indicated. The first argument of the function is the observed value of the chi-square statistic.
